Budget 2020: Finance Minister Gives Breakdown.

The Minister of Finance, Budget and National Planning, Zainab Ahmed, has broken down the proposed 2020 budget, putting the total revenue at 8.15trillion naira.

She said that the total expenditure for the proposed budget stands at 10.33 trillion naira.

The honorable minister made the disclosure on Monday during a presentation aimed at discussing the details of the 2020 budget proposal presented to the National Assembly by President Muhammadu Buhari.

She said, “This is the first time in a long time that this presentation is done early in an effort to get back to the Jan-Dec budget cycle.

“Another will be held after passage by NASS”.
She announced that the Federal Government is planning several key reforms including the Strategic Revenue Growth Initiative.

According to her, the proposal is accompanied by a Finance Bill which has five Strategic Objectives, they are:

1. Promoting Fiscal Equity by mitigating instances of regressive taxation.

2. Reforming domestic tax laws to align with global best practices;

3. Introducing tax incentives 4 investments in infrastructure&capital markets.

4. Supporting micro,small&medium-sized businesses in line with Ease of Doing business reforms.

5. Raising revenues for the government.

Mrs. Ahmed explained that the 2020 Appropriation Bill is designed to be a budget of Fiscal consolidation to strengthen our macroeconomic environment; Investing in critical infrastructure, human capital development & enabling institutions especially key job-creating sectors.

And also Incentivising private sector investment essential to complement governments’ development plans, policies & programs; iv.

Enhancing our social investment programs to further deepen their impact on marginalized/most vulnerable Nigerians.

Delivering the closing remarks at the end of the Budget 2020 breakdown by the Minister of Finance, the Minster of State for Budget and National Planning Prince Clem Agba said there is a need to create a brand new paradigm for the management of the nations economy through proper planning.

In his words, “To pass the final litmus test, our new push coming on the heels of Mr. President’s commitment to take 100 million Nigerians out of poverty in the next 10 years will be accountable. It will be responsible. It will be inclusive. It will be open, it will be transparent and will require planning.”

“I want to use this opportunity to thank the President and Commander In Chief of the Armed Forces of Nigeria, President Muhammadu Buhari for his unwavering commitment to statecraft and public good. His mandate to return our country to the January to December budget cycle is a great stride towards institutionalizing prediction of the economic direction of our dear country. This we believe will improve the confidence of investors and development partners in our economy with concomitant growth and development.”

Thanks to my dear sister, the Hon. Minister of Finance, Budget and National Planning for her industry and commitment to the attainment of a sound financial management of Nigerias resources.”

Prince Agba also thanked Members of the National Assembly for their readiness to ensure a speedy passage of the 2020 budget saying he believes it will usher in a new direction in National Planning and Development.

He lauded the governments championing of the Open Government Partnership, (OGP) in the current administration

In attendance at the presentation was the Minister of Information, Lai Mohammed, Minister of State for Transportation, Gbemisola Saraki, Minister of State for Health, Adeleke Mamora, among other government officials.
